Solution for (3p+2)=(7p-2) equation:


Simplifying
(3p + 2) = (7p + -2)

Reorder the terms:
(2 + 3p) = (7p + -2)

Remove parenthesis around (2 + 3p)
2 + 3p = (7p + -2)

Reorder the terms:
2 + 3p = (-2 + 7p)

Remove parenthesis around (-2 + 7p)
2 + 3p = -2 + 7p

Solving
2 + 3p = -2 + 7p

Solving for variable 'p'.

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7p' to each side of the equation.
2 + 3p + -7p = -2 + 7p + -7p

Combine like terms: 3p + -7p = -4p
2 + -4p = -2 + 7p + -7p

Combine like terms: 7p + -7p = 0
2 + -4p = -2 + 0
2 + -4p = -2

Add '-2' to each side of the equation.
2 + -2 + -4p = -2 + -2

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0
0 + -4p = -2 + -2
-4p = -2 + -2

Combine like terms: -2 + -2 = -4
-4p = -4

Divide each side by '-4'.
p = 1

Simplifying
p = 1
